What are Forged Fittings?

Forged fittings are among the most vital components in piping systems, and are used to join two or more pipes, adapt to different pipe sizes, or change the direction of flow. They are created through the forging process, which involves shaping metal under extreme heat and pressure. This results in fittings that are exceptionally strong, durable, and resistant to deformation, making them ideal for high-pressure and high-temperature applications.

The forging process enables them to offer better pressure resistance compared to regular cast fittings. They provide a secure, permanent, or semi-permanent connection that ensures the integrity of the entire fluid or gas line.
